Braden West Group This paper explores issues in developing and implementing a Competency-Based human resource Development Strategy . The paper summarizes a literature review on how competency models can improve HR performance. A case study is presented of American Medical Systems (AMS), a mid-sized health-care and medical device company, where the model is being used to improve employee performance and gain a competitive advantage. While there are numerous benefits from using behavior-based competency models, there are also some challenges. Keywords: Competency Models, Performance Improvement, Organization Development Competency-Based practices are popular among large and mid-sized employers as an integral tool for talent selection, retention, and Development .
